Do I need special hardware to test Vision Pro apps?
For initial development, we use Apple’s visionOS simulator. However, full testing requires access to the Vision Pro device, which we support internally.
Can you port an existing Unity app to Vision Pro?
Yes. We can migrate existing Unity projects to visionOS using Unity PolySpatial and Apple's APIs, while optimizing for performance and UI/UX standards.

What’s the difference between Quest 2, 3, and Quest Pro for development?
While all support core features, Quest 3 and Pro offer better passthrough, depth sensing, and hand tracking. We help tailor AR/VR development to the hardware's strengths.
